| Currently serving as the department chair, Prof.
Yeldan received his Ph.D. from University of Minnesota, USA, and joined
the Department of Economics at Bilkent in 1988. A recent survey conducted
by the European Economic Association ranked Prof. Yeldan among the
most productive economists in the world as measured by the number
of pages in Social Science Citation Index-listed journals. In 1994,
he was a visiting scholar at the University of Minnesota where he
taught Applied General Equilibrium Analysis. He later visited International
Food Policy Research Institute, Washington, D.C. and worked as a research
associate. Dr. Yeldan's recent work focuses on empirical, dynamic
general equilibrium models of the Turkish economy, and applications
of endogenous growth systems. He is a fellow of Economic Research
Forum (ERF) and was a recipient of Young Scientist Award of Turkish
Academy of Sciences (TÜBA) in 1998.
